Sustainable Practices in Clay Brick Production: Germany's Leading Example
Sustainability has emerged as a critical concept in today's world, with the need to reduce environmental impact and preserve resources becoming increasingly important. One industry that has made significant strides in sustainable practices is clay brick production, and Germany stands as a leading example in this field. Through the implementation of innovative technologies and rigorous standards, Germany has revolutionized the way clay bricks are manufactured, setting new benchmarks for the entire industry.
One of the key sustainable practices implemented in German clay brick production is the use of energy-efficient kilns. Traditional kilns often consumed large amounts of fossil fuels, contributing to greenhouse gas emissions and air pollution. In contrast, Germany has embraced advanced technologies such as tunnel kilns and vertical shaft kilns, which not only improve energy efficiency but also reduce carbon dioxide emissions. These kilns are designed to optimize heat utilization, ensuring minimal energy waste and environmental impact.
Furthermore, Germany's commitment to sustainability extends beyond kiln technology. As the demand for clay bricks continues to grow, the industry faces the challenge of sourcing raw materials without depleting natural resources. Germany has successfully addressed this issue through responsible mining practices and resource management. Clay extraction is carefully planned to prevent soil erosion and preserve biodiversity. In addition, the industry has implemented recycling initiatives, using crushed brick as a valuable raw material in the production process. This not only reduces waste but also conserves natural resources and lowers energy consumption.
Another aspect of sustainability in German clay brick production is product durability. The German industry has focused on producing high-quality bricks that stand the test of time. This approach promotes sustainable construction practices as it reduces the need for frequent repairs or replacements, ultimately reducing waste generation. Builders and architects in Germany recognize the value of long-lasting clay bricks, as they contribute to the overall sustainability and lifespan of a building.
German clay brick manufacturers also prioritize water conservation. Production processes have been optimized to minimize water usage, and wastewater is treated and reused whenever possible. By adopting efficient water management practices, the industry significantly reduces its impact on local water sources, ensuring the availability of this vital resource for future generations.
In addition to these practices within the production process, Germany's clay brick industry emphasizes eco-friendly transportation. A well-established logistics system ensures the efficient delivery of bricks to construction sites, minimizing fuel consumption and greenhouse gas emissions. The use of alternative transportation methods such as rail and waterways further reduces the industry's carbon footprint.
In conclusion, Germany's sustainable practices in clay brick production serve as a model for the industry worldwide. Through the implementation of energy-efficient kilns, responsible resource management, durability-focused production, water conservation, and eco-friendly transportation, Germany has demonstrated that economic growth and environmental stewardship can go hand in hand. By embracing these sustainable practices, the German clay brick industry sets a benchmark for the global construction sector, proving that sustainable development is not only possible but also essential for a greener future.
